Changelog — Keyfall v3.2.0. The password reset flow revamp renamed RESET_MAIL_KEY to RESETFLOW_SIGNING_SECRET to reflect that it now signs the one-time reset tokens rather than just authenticating the mailer. The old name is no longer read anywhere; deployments still carrying it will fail the boot-time config check with a clear error. Update your env files before upgrading, since there is no fallback or migration shim. After renaming, the relevant line in your environment file should look like this.

secret setting of kawip-tajop: RELAY_SECRET8=11ecb20c

Minutes — Management Meeting, Brandle Foods

Attendees: heads of department. Topic: franchise agreement with Orvik Holdings.

Terms reviewed: ten-year term, 5% royalty, regional exclusivity in the Davenmoor corridor. Legal flagged the termination clause; revision requested. Signing targeted for month-end. Actions assigned to operations and legal. The confidential commercial rationale is recorded below.

internal memo for yahag-tahog: The pricing group signed off on a budget of $152.8 million for Project Soriel.

The Orvane Labs bike cage and the east and west parking gates operate on separate access schedules, and facilities desk staff should note that visitor vehicles may only use the west gate between 07:00 and 19:00. Cyclists requesting cage access must show a valid day pass, and their details should be entered in the access ledger before the cage is opened. Gates must never be propped open, even briefly, during deliveries. When a manual override is required at either gate, use the code below.

staff pass of fadup-fawig = bdg-FUNKS-4

Handover Note — Director Transition

The pilot with the Fennimore & Dale retail chain runs through the end of next quarter. Twelve stores carry the Opaline shelf-sensor units; weekly data reviews happen Thursdays with their merchandising team. Early accuracy numbers are solid, though restock alerts need tuning. Contract renewal talks begin in eight weeks, so prioritize that relationship early. The pilot ties into a larger plan you should know about, noted confidentially below.

internal memo for kahop-yajof: The steering committee signed off on a budget of $12.6 million for Project Jorwyn. The renewal with Quenoxox Logistics closes at $16.8 million a year, 48 percent above the last contract.